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
778 817631630 2833 65
108970 765922 71002567
108970 765922 71002567
665421412 98579 48801
All about undefined
Interested in learning more?
108970 765922 71002567
665421412 98579 48801
See more
22 0825271
128 7779216 39490 785505
See more
7401 01 0238
9501 138 83206998238 23810781416
See more